Transaction 143fc7ddc6963313212760424f2590f0ebdb0c4d72a17cecfe2c8a2389c76ed0
1 Input
1 Output
-
143fc7ddc6963313212760424f2590f0ebdb0c4d72a17cecfe2c8a2389c76ed0:0
- value
- 33986
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 97cfe0ab7c20446feb68d05bf7afd039b7a8277c52d126b7988c265fba8e2e6e
- address
- bc1pjl87p2muypzxl6mg6pdl0t7s8xm6sfmu2tgjdduc3sn9lw5w9ehqk9exez